Output 37e9661df32fc8fa7ef68cf5f1ded88bff4c0345b993fbe88897ea9b28dab17c:30

value
1002260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a885b71c2769077086000e30138c5f5cf771d651 OP_EQUAL
address
3H45dUHpRq8LmboTSc9xzszxKmPwBBEcit
transaction
37e9661df32fc8fa7ef68cf5f1ded88bff4c0345b993fbe88897ea9b28dab17c
spent
true